Mathieu Desnoyers <mathieu.desnoyers@polymtl.ca> writes: > > The measurements I get (in cycles): > enable interrupts (STI) disable interrupts (CLI) local CMPXCHG > IA32 (P4) 112 82 26 > x86_64 AMD64 125 102 19
What exactly did you benchmark here? On K8 CLI/STI are only supposed to be a few cycles. pushf/popf might me more expensive, but not that much.
